Tobermory’s 3,180-foot paved runway is optimized for turboprops, very light jets, and light jets, with select midsize jets able to operate based on weight and weather conditions. Popular aircraft include the Pilatus PC-12, King Air 350, Phenom 100, and Citation CJ series.

Tobermory is the premier choice for direct access to the northern Bruce Peninsula, especially for travelers with destinations near the village or along Lake Huron’s coast. Wiarton (YVV) and Owen Sound (YOS) are practical alternatives for southern Peninsula access, each with their own FBO services and longer runways.
